The meaning of Myerscough

English: habitational name from either of two places in Lancashire called Myerscough, both named from Old Norse mýrr ‘marsh’ + skógr ‘wood’.

How common is the last name Myerscough in the United States?

Based on the Decennial U.S. Census data, the popularity of the surname Myerscough has slightly decreased in rank from 94,676 in 2000 to 94,730 in 2010, representing a marginal change of -0.06. However, the count reflecting the number of people carrying the surname increased by approximately 8% from 179 in 2000 to 193 in 2010. The proportion per 100,000 remained unchanged at 0.07.

Race and Ethnicity of people with the last name Myerscough

The Decennial U.S. Census data also provides insights into the ethnic identity associated with the surname Myerscough. In 2000, an overwhelming majority of those carrying the surname identified as White, specifically 96.65%. This percentage dropped slightly to 94.3% in 2010. No individuals identified as Asian/Pacific Islander, Black, or American Indian and Alaskan Native during these years. A noticeable change occurred in the Hispanic category which saw an increase from 0% in 2000 to 3.63% in 2010. The "Two or more races" category showed no records for this surname.
